How they compare

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land currently reports 68.7 against 42.67 in Western Asia, a difference of 26.03.

That makes United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land's figure about 1.6 times Western Asia's.

Across all 23 years both countries report, United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land has been ahead every year.

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 25th and Western Asia ranks 24th of 188 countries.

United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land Western Asia Difference Ahead
2000s 62.2 24.04 38.17 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land
2010s 64.23 30.09 34.15 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land
2020s 67.19 39.42 27.77 United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Imputed observations are not based on national data, are subject to high uncertainty and should not be used for country comparisons or rankings. This series is based on the 13th ICLS definitions. This measure of labour productivity is calculated using data on GDP (in constant 2021 international dollars at PPP) derived from the World Development Indicators database of the World Bank. For more information, refer to the ILO Modelled Estimates (ILOEST) database description.
